我正在尝试使用NSApplicationDelegate
和openFiles
方法尝试抓取用户放在我的(Cocoa)App的停靠栏图标上的随机文件列表的路径。
将单个文件或文件夹拖到应用程序的停靠栏图标上时,我的解决方案可以正常运行。
但是,当将多个文件或文件夹拖到图标上时,它通常无法执行其工作。执行此操作时,始终会调用openFiles
,但通常,它提供的文件列表不完整。分别传递相同的文件非常有效。
有人知道我做错了吗?
(我在Snow Leopard 10.6.8上)
-
更新:我上传了一个重播问题的测试程序:https://fgt.bo/if6
我的plist文件有问题吗?